Each application card also has a context menu. To open the application card context menu:
- either right-click anywhere in the card
- or hover your mouse pointer over the card to display its 3-dot context menu icon in the top right. Then click the 3-dot icon icon.
Repository Application Context Menu
Applications also have different context menu available from the repository. To display the repository application context menu, right-click the name of an application.
